Playing the crime- ghting hero who refused to use a gun, Richard once told fans
it was quite a challenge. “It was really complicated to shoot MacGyver,” he said. “Because we had a new concept of a TV hero who didn’t use a gun to solve that problem. You saw him see the problem, see him see elements of the solution, see him collecting it, putting it together and then you see him, you know, weaving whatever toy he needs to solve that problem.”
MacGyver premiered in September 1985 and went on to win the hearts of millions of viewers until its cancellation in 1992. At that time, Richard spoke of feeling “fried” after the show’s relentless lming schedule left him with “no life at all”.
Five years later he stepped back into acting, this time as Colonel Jonathan “Jack” O’Neil in science ction drama Stargate SG-1. However, Richard walked away from the show in 2004 to focus on daughter Wylie Quinn Annarose, who he had with his now ex-partner Apryl Prose in 1998.
